About Akemi Wakisaka

Akemi Wakisaka is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Rheumatology, having authored 97 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include T-cell and B-cell Immunology (21 papers), Genetic Neurodegenerative Diseases (21 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(17 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(17 papers), T-cell and Retrovirus Studies (12 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(11 papers), Systemic Lupus Erythematosus Research (7 papers) and Immunodeficiency and Autoimmune Disorders (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(1.0k citations), Immunology and Allergy (215 citations), Ophthalmology (297 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(465 citations) and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(354 citations). Akemi Wakisaka has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Masashi Aizawa, Shigeo Ohno, Shinichi Hirose, Hisao Matsuda, M Ohguchi, Paul I. Terasaki, Katsuaki Itakura, Takashi Yoshiki, Miki Aizawa and Sen‐itiroh Hakomori. Their work appears in journals such as Immunogenetics, Journal of the Neurological Sciences, Human Immunology, Vox Sanguinis and The Journal of Immunology.
